Crisis and Emergency Contacts
The following resources are suggested contacts if your are experiencing a crisis situation including potential self-harm. As in all immediate life-threatening medical situations, it is recommended that you access local Emergency Medical Services by calling 911.

National Suicide Prevention Lifeline: This is a 24 hour, toll free crisis hotline which serves to link individuals in crisis to the services of a local crisis center. 1-800-273-TALK (8255)

Covenant House Nineline Hotline: This is a 24 hour, toll free crisis hotline which serves to provide immediate confidential crisis intervention with additional referrals to various community resources.  1-800-999-9999
